Quick context for the security review: the Quillbase orders table is partitioned by month, and a scheduled job creates next month's partition ten days early while detaching anything older than eighteen months. Detached partitions are encrypted and shipped to cold storage before the drop — nothing is deleted in place, so there's no window where retained data is unprotected. The job runs under a scoped role with no read access to row contents. It picks up its settings from the block below.

config for hahip-kaguf:
[holath]
port = 8443
region = north-4
host = holath.tolvaqlabs.internal
timeout_ms = 1000
retries = 2

### Step 4: Apply remediation config

Per the Quillhaven stale-cache postmortem, the old invalidation settings allowed entries to outlive their source records by hours. Before promoting build 14.2, replace the cache tier's config with the corrected values below. Do not merge with existing overrides; the postmortem traced the bug to a partial override. Verify all three regions restart cleanly, then sign off in the release tracker. The corrected configuration to apply is as follows.

config for faweg-yajef:
DRUIX_HOST=druix.lumicsys.internal
DRUIX_PORT=9000

From outgoing director Priya Ashdown to incoming director Col Renner: the Lumora subscription pilot in the Westvale region has seen churn rise to 14% over two cycles, concentrated among small accounts onboarded without training. Renewal outreach scripts have been revised and a retention credit trialled with modest effect. Col will take over the weekly churn review from next week; sales leads should route escalations to him directly. The confidential note below sets out the retention strategy under consideration.

internal memo for kawip-hadug: Headcount on the Wenwyn team goes from 7 to 140 by the end of January. Gross margin on Wenwyn came in at 20 percent against a plan of 15 percent.

Hey release folks — heads up that the new SQL linting rules for the Quillbrook repo go live Monday. Anything with unaliased joins or naked SELECT * will fail CI, so flag tickets from customers asking why their hotfix branches bounce. Tansy wrote a migration script that auto-fixes most files. If someone needs to reference the exact lint build, it's the token right below.

session token of kageg-tahop = htk14_af3c1ccccb7dcf